History: The years 2019 and 2020 saw the President of India assenting to the four labour codes viz. Code on Wages 2019, Code on Social Security 2020, Industrial Relations Code 2020 and Occupational Safety, Health and Working Conditions Code 2020, intended to consolidate labour law regime in India. While these codes await notifications from the Government of India to be made effective as law (barring provisions relating to Central Advisory Board on minimum wages), a need is felt across industries to be prepared for certain operational and financial impact arising therefrom as regards their workforce.

 

Key Learning from the webinar: While several compliances including procedural aspects have been left to the appropriate government to set out by way of rules, there are some provisions in the codes which are already catching everyone’s attention. These include express recognition of fixed term employment (albeit with conditions), prohibition on engagement of outsourced workforce in core operations, implications of the revised definition of ‘wages’, extension of restrictions relating to strikes and lockouts to all establishments, and wider application of provisions relating to inter-state migrant workers as well as aspects of overtime, working conditions, health and safety.
